Year 9 Career Taster- It’s a child play
Our Year 9 students continue to explore careers, this time some of our students attended a career taster on early childhood education at North TAFE in Leederville on 13 October. This session was very practical where our students learnt to prepare activities and resources for toddlers and kindy. They also learnt how to look after babies. It was a fun filled day!





The Career Department- Year 11 and 12
At our school we take pride in delivering the best resources to improve the learning outcome of our students. We have purchased a subscription to the Career Department website (https://www.thecareersdepartment.com/) to enrich the curriculum of our Career and enterprise students in 2023 ( Year 11 and 12). This tool offers career planning and development, networking, virtual work experience and micro credential skills training. Parents and carers can get access to it as well.
We had a session with our upcoming Year 11 and 12 career enterprise students and teacher to present the tool seeking feedback on the benefit of implementing the tool at our school. The feedback was very positive from our students - they thought that this tool will improve greatly their learning outcomes in their chosen subject.
